Bounce the Bunny


 

Bounce loved springtime; it was her favourite time of year. The grass was fresh and green, and the spring sunshine warmed the ground, which had been so cold and hard over the winter months.

It was time to come out of the burrow and show off her wonderful pink coat. Most of the other rabbits had the same old boring brown fur coats, but Bounce’s coat was the most beautiful shade of pink. The other bunnies looked on in admiration.

Now, Bounce’s mummy Pearl was a beautiful white rabbit with long elegant whiskers and her daddy Twitcher was a lovely pale grey. Twitcher wasn’t keen on eating grass, he had a great fondness for tomatoes, he loved them, and he would eat them day and night if he could.

“I’m not bothered about carrots. I’m not bothered about grass. Just give me Tomatoes!” he would say.

Not only that but one day while out hopping around the fields he stepped into a big puddle of red paint, which had been dropped by a farmer whilst painting his gate. So Bounce’s mummy to this day insists that is why she came out such a wonderful colour.

The other rabbits were envious of Bounce’s fine coat and sometimes would not let her join in their games of hide and seek, or who could jump the highest. So, she would take herself off and go collecting flowers in the nearby field.

One day she decided to go a little bit further away. She saw in the distance a field full of flowers. It was a blaze of colour. Bounce decided to try to find it, so she hopped further and further away from her home. “Not far now” she said to herself, “nearly there.”

Finally, she arrived at the beautiful field and immediately started picking the sweet smelling flowers. Soon she had her arms full and could not carry anymore.

“Time to go home” she said to herself “what a huge bunch I have collected, now which way do I go?” She started looking around. “Which way did I come?”

She looked over at the green fields in the distance and they all looked the same. “Oh Dear”, she said, “I think I am lost, I can’t find my way home.”

Now over in Bounce’s field, the other rabbits who had not let her play hide and seek with them earlier, were starting to miss her. “Has anyone seen Bounce?” shouted Bobtail.

Not for ages” replied Fluffy. They all agreed they had not seen Bounce for a long time. “Where is she” said Fluffy. Where could she be?” the bunnies started searching for her behind bushes, down burrows, in haystacks and calling her name, but she was nowhere to be seen.

Then all of a sudden, whiskers shouted “LOOK! Over there.” She was pointing into the distance at a bunch of flowers running up and down a field on the other side of the valley. All the other rabbits stopped and stared. Then Fluffy said “It’s got to be Bounce.”

“You’re right, agreed Bobtail “Who else would collect so many flowers.”

“BOUNCE! BOUNCE! BOUNCE!” shouted all the rabbits, trying to get her attention. But it was no good she was too far away to hear. She just kept on running up and down.

“We must help her” said Fluffy. “Yes” said Bobtail, “lets form a line and all go together, so no one gets lost on the way.”

So they form a line and set off to help Bounce. They reached the field of in no time at all. But she was at the top and they were at the bottom.

Bounce was very worried now. The sun would soon be starting to set. What should she do? Then she heard a shout of “Bounce!” it was her friends.

She could not believe it, her friends had come to rescue her. “Fluffy, Bobtail, Whiskers,” she cried “Thank you, thank you all.”

“I saw all the pretty flowers over here and could not resist them, when I had finished picking the flowers. I couldn’t find my way home. All the fields looked the same. I didn’t know what to do.” said a tearful Bounce

“We missed you Bounce” said Bobtail.

“We are so sorry that we didn’t let you play with us” said Fluffy

“We’ve come to show you the way home” said Whiskers.

All the rabbits gathered around her and off they went. They followed the path they had left on the way and quickly made their way safely back home.

Bounce wanted to say a big “Thank you” to all her friends. She thought for a moment and then started to make beautiful necklaces and crowns, from the sweet, bright flowers. All her friends went home as bright and colourful bunnies’ just like Bounce.
